California and R-1
California R-1 School District operates three schools in California and serves 1, 357 students, as of August 2008.
In an agreement worked out between the city and the school district, the school will continue to use the pool during the school year for the students of the California R-1 School District.
The swimming pool was acquired from the California R-1 School District in 2007.
